Abstract

The properties of polysulfone-modified epoxy binders, which are intrinsic for their high deformation characteristics, are given. The experimental results of the impact strength, bend strength, and glass transition temperature are given. The procedure of the measurement of the temperature range, at which there is a glass transition, is given. It has been shown that the amount of the introduced polysulfone to the binder has a greater influence on the temperature range where the change of the glass transition temperature occurs rather than its mean value.
